本文主要是介绍Qt5 编译使用 QFtp,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!
作者: 一去、二三里
个人微信号: iwaleon
微信公众号: 高效程序员
使用 QNetworkAccessManager 可以实现 Ftp 的上传/下载功能(参考:Qt之FTP上传/下载),但有些原本 QFtp 有的功能 QNetworkAccessManager 却没有提供,例如:list、cd、remove、mkdir、rmdir、rename 等。这种情况下,就不得不使用 QFtp,值得庆幸的是 QFtp 一直在维护,只需要下载源码自行编译即可使用。
QFtp
下载
从 GitHub 下载 QFtp:
https://github.com/qt/qtftp
或者使用命令下载 :
git clone https://github.com/qtproject/qtftp
完成之后,可以看到 qtftp 中包含源码及示例。
配置
下面,以 MSVC为例。
打开 src/qftp/qftp.pro,将默认
这篇关于Qt5 编译使用 QFtp的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!